Why It Matters

Using landscaping bark has several important benefits:

  • Weed Suppression: A thick layer of bark can significantly reduce weed growth, which means less time spent pulling weeds.
  • Soil Health: Bark decomposes over time, enriching the soil and providing nutrients to your plants.
  • Moisture Retention: Bark helps retain soil moisture, reducing the need for frequent watering.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: A fresh layer of bark enhances the overall look of your landscaping, increasing curb appeal and potentially your property value.
